RCMP reported that a 37-year-old woman and a 2-year-old managed to escape the flames, a 40-year-old man was rescued by a neighbour, and three children, ages 5, 6, and 9, were rescued by arriving firefighters. The 6-year-old girl, a relative who was visiting the family, later died in the hospital; the other children continue to receive medical care while the 40-year-old is said to be in stable condition.
